According to the National Center for Missing & Exploited Children (NCMEC), of the 27,000 missing children reported to NCMEC in 2017, 5% were family abductions. According to the NCMEC, family abductions or parental kidnappings typically occur “when a child is taken, wrongfully retained, or concealed by a parent or other family member depriving another individual of their custody or visitation rights.”
